Remembering FO Nathaniel Barry

A wreath was laid on Rememrance Sunday at the RAF Memorial Stone erected in memory of Flying Officer Nathaniel John Merriman Barry R.A.F.V.R. FO Barry, served in No. 501 Squadron, lost his life on 7 October 1940 when just 22 years old his Hurricane V6800 crashed near where the Memorial Stone now stands. One of Churchill's few, FO Barry's Memorial was dedicated on 26th May 2007 by Shoreham Aircraft Museum.
